Fresh from releasing her "Tales From The Sun" album, Dinka has been wowing us with her distinctive and gorgeously melodic sound for some time - thanks to Anjunadeep classics like "Zero Altitude" and "Aircraft" . "The Sleeping Beauty" , her latest effort on Anjunadeep, is a real treat and captures the melodic musician at her creative peak. Underpinned by slick, watertight production and trademark house grooves, the Original Mix awakes from its slumber with a blend of bubbling keys and divine floataway hooks that mark the mix out as one of Dinka’s finest moments.
Komytea probably wouldn’t have been the most obvious choice to give “The Sleeping Beauty” a bit of a re-tweak, but they have taken to the task with great gusto. Taking the melodic parts of the original, they twist, turn and warp them into something that’s very much in their own inimitable style. By throwing in intermittent dashes of electric guitar and a grimy, unpolished, chainsaw bassline, they’ve managed to turn the demeanour of the original completely upside down into something that’s unimaginably menacing and sinister.
